    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="https://forum.asrock.com/member_profile.asp?PF=19929">Z_Beta</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 19133<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 23 Jun 2021 at 8:41pm<br /><br />Hello,<br /><br />I currently have a problem with my Asrock h110 pro BTC+ motherboard<br />I bought 2 days ago this motherboard with a Corsair RM 1000X power supply, 8GB DDR4 RAM and an Intel Pentium Gold G5420 processor (3.8 GHz).<br />I mounted the motherboard as indicated on the manual provided, but when I press the power button on the motherboard, the ventirad turns on 1 second and then stops. no other noise and that's it.<br /><br />There is no display on the screen I plugged in.<br />I then tried to change the position of the RAM, nothing. <br />I changed the RAM, nothing. <br />I changed the CMOS battery, nothing. <br />I unplugged everything and plugged it back in, nothing.<br />I put an M2 ssd with an OS, nothing.<br />I plugged in a graphics card, the GPU fans turn on for a second like the CPU and stop.<br />The power supply was used for my NAS server and it is functional for sure, I tried it after the tests on the motherboard and it works very well<br /><br />I am out of solution. Does anyone have any idea how to fix my problem?<br /><br />I thank you in advance for your help.<br />BeTa<br />]]>
